OLLIE MITCHELL

AN INTERVIEW WITH OLLIE MITCHELL

    Ollie Mitchell was one of Hollywood’s top studio trumpet players in the 60’s, 70’s and early 80’s. He became part of the sound of pop music on thousands of records, TV shows, jingles, cartoons, and movies during those years. He has recorded with Barbara Streisand, BB King, Bing Crosby, Bobby Dari, Carole King, Donna Summer, Duke Ellington, Ella Firzgerald, Elvis Presley, Eric Clapton, Harry James, James Brown, Nat ‘King’ Cole, Sammy Davis, Jr., Santana, Ray Charles, The Jakson 5, Tom Jones and The Rolling Stones.

    Ollie was started on the trumpet at age 5 by his father, Harold (Pappy) Mitchell who played first trumpet in the Jazz Singer, (the first sound movie). Pappy was one of the top studio trumpet players, playing on all the MGM musicals until he retired in 1948. Pappy put Ollie through very strict training which gave him the skills he needed for his career.

    Ollie also did a lot of teaching and formed a school with trombonist Bob Edmondson devoted to developing young big band musicians. The school came to an end in 1964 when Bob and Ollie became part of the original Tijuana Brass.

     I met Ollie in January of 2009 where at the age of 82 he was playing and leading his big band in Hawaii. This DVD, filmed at that time, is an interview of Ollie discussing his areer, his philosophy of trumpet playing, and his comments on the history of the music industry as he experienced it.

-Scott Weiss
